How to Trailer Suspension Hangers Attach to a Trailer
Question:
I need to move the axle on a utility trailer forward..... are there hangers that can be bolted on instead of welded. Its a light duty trailer built with 2x2 x .125 tube, capacity 1500 lbs
asked by: George H
Expert Reply:
Suspension hangers for trailers like the part # 115917 need to be welded on. There are no options for bolt on hangers so your best option would be to have a qualified welder/fabricator move your current ones.
The goal should be for axle place that when the trailer is loaded it would have 10-15 percent of the total weight of the trailer as tongue weight.
